Kacey Musgraves has just helped set a new world record!

On National Colour Day, the Grammy-winning artist and Country Music Hall of Fame and Museum set a Guinness World Record for the Largest Display of Colouring Pages.

In support of the “Kacey Musgraves: All Of The Colours” exhibit in the museum’s Mike Curb Conservatory, the 500-pound, rainbow-shaped display was unveiled Tuesday with the help of Musgraves herself.

The display features 550 colouring pages submitted by people from over 30 states.

“Thank you to everyone who sent in pages or came to colour with us! The record belongs to you, too,” writes the Country Music Hall of Fame on their Instagram post.

The “Kacey Musgraves: All of the Colours” exhibition runs through June 7, 2020.
